Rosario Gagliardi redesigned and rebuilt the Cathedral of St. George on the ruins of the previous one with the impressive facade and the majestic dome standing behind.. The vertical layout of the building is enhanced by the large and high staircase that connects the church to the main square of Ragusa Ibla. WebMar 20, 2024 · The church records of Palermo, for example, start about 1350, and the baptistry in Firenze has records from the early 1400s. Church records are crucial for research before the civil government started keeping vital records, which began about 1809 to 1820. After that, church records continued to be kept but often contain less information.
